avere del lavoro davanti a te

used to say that something is very difficult and one will need to put a lot of effort into doing it

The team has their work cut out for them as they prepare for the championship match against the strongest opponents in the league.
With only a week left until the deadline, I have my work cut out for me to complete this extensive research project.
